Output 271837127bd0de4fd6e326da2888409b9ff88cb43bfab7e8fa5751467c579043:0

value
23630213
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43d0d8be60bc04ce7783c6a11911f82240effde9 OP_EQUALVERIFY OP_CHECKSIG
address
17BaTmp5mHmW9xVAzNY7rzLVTUG7QVS9u8
transaction
271837127bd0de4fd6e326da2888409b9ff88cb43bfab7e8fa5751467c579043
spent
true